An unstrained horizontal spring has a length of 0.44 m and a spring constant of 238 N/m. Two small charged objects are attached to this spring, one at each end. The charges on the objects have equal magnitudes. Because of these charges, the spring stretches by 0.029 m relative to its unstrained length. Determine the possible algebraic signs and the magnitude of the charges.
